Birth: 1942-11-21 Residence: Bryantown, Maryland Death: Monday, September 22, 2014 Laid to Rest: Monday, September 29, 2014 in the Resurrection Cemetery, Clinton, Maryland
Paul Conrad Webster Sr., age 71, of Bryantown, MD passed on September 22, 2014.
Retired from Pepco. Beloved husband of Kathleen Webster. Loving father of Paul Webster Jr. Brother to Edward Webster (Sharon). Predeceased by his parents and brother Billy Webster.
